Headline Decolonization Committee Adopts Reports on Gilbert and Ellice, Pictcairn, Solomon, Niue and Tokelau Islands, Opens General Debate on Portuguese-Administered Territories 
Caption Description The Special Committee of 24 on decolonization today adopted a report on conditions in three United Kingdom-administered Territories in the South Pacific-the Gilbert and Ellice Island, Pitcairn and the Solomon Island.  Also adopted was a report containing conclusions and recommendations on conditions in Niue and the Tokelau Islands, two Pacific Territories administered by New Zealand.  The Committee also began a general debate on the situation in the Portuguese-administered Territories of Angola, Mozambique, Guinea (Bissau) and Cape Verde.  Statements were made by Sweden and the United Republic of Tanzania.
Salim A. Salim (left) of the United Republic of Tanzania, Chairman of the Committee, conversing with (from left):  Manuel Jorge, advisor to the Central Committee of the Movement for the Liberation of Angola (MPLA); Jorge Rebelo, a member of the Central and Executive Committees of the Mozambique Liberation Front (FRELIMO); and Sharfuddine M. Khan, (FRELIMO).
